Universal screening for biliary atresia using an infant stool color card in Taiwan

Early diagnosis of biliary atresia in infants is crucial. A national infant stool color card screening system significantly improved early detection and timely Kasai operations, leading to better outcomes.

Background:

  • Biliary atresia is a leading cause of pediatric liver disease mortality.
  • Delayed diagnosis hinders the effectiveness of the Kasai operation, the primary treatment.

Purpose of the Study:

  • To evaluate the impact of a national infant stool color card screening system on early diagnosis and treatment of biliary atresia.
  • To assess improvements in surgical timing and postoperative outcomes.

Main Methods:

  • Integration of an infant stool color card into national child health booklets since 2004.
  • Mandatory reporting of abnormal stool colors to a registry center within 24 hours.
  • Analysis of screening sensitivity, Kasai operation timing, and jaundice-free rates.

Main Results:

  • Screening sensitivity for biliary atresia before 60 days increased from 72.5% (2004) to 97.1% (2005).
  • The rate of Kasai operations before 60 days rose from 60% (2004) to 74.3% (2005).
  • Jaundice-free rates at 3 months post-operation significantly improved from 37.0% (historical) to 59.5% (2004-2005).

Conclusions:

  • Universal stool color card screening facilitates earlier referral for infants with biliary atresia.
  • Timely Kasai operation due to early screening leads to improved postoperative outcomes.
